Bug Description
Binary package hint: gwibber
Gwibber has no accounts. I am setting up a twitter account. I clicked authorize.
What happens:
A little twitter web page opens in the gwibber application and asks for my username and password
What should happen:
I expect my webbrowser to open a new tab with the twitter "authorise this application" page. I have already signed into twitter on my web browser.
The point of OAuth is so applications don't have to save passwords, however i can't know if gwibber is saving my password.
